upm  1.6.0
Sensor/Actuator repository for libmraa (v1.9.0)
Public Member Functions | Protected Member Functions | Static Protected Member Functions | Protected Attributes | List of all members
DS18B20 Class Reference

Public Member Functions

synchronized void delete ()
 
 DS18B20 (int uart)
 
void init ()
 
void update (int index)
 
void update ()
 
float getTemperature (long index, boolean fahrenheit)
 
float getTemperature (long index)
 
void setResolution (long index, DS18B20_RESOLUTIONS_T res)
 
void copyScratchPad (long index)
 
void recallEEPROM (long index)
 
int devicesFound ()
 
String getId (long index)
 

Protected Member Functions

 DS18B20 (long cPtr, boolean cMemoryOwn)
 
void finalize ()
 

Static Protected Member Functions

static long getCPtr (DS18B20 obj)
 

Protected Attributes

transient boolean swigCMemOwn
 

The documentation for this class was generated from the following file: